在数字化时代,网站已经成为企业展示形象、服务客户的重要平台。一个优秀的网站不仅需要美观的界面,更需要高效的功能和良好的用户体验。量推前端,作为网站优化的重要环节,掌握其技巧对于提升用户体验至关重要。本文将揭秘量推前端的优化技巧,帮助您轻松提升网站的用户体验。
一、网站速度优化
网站速度是影响用户体验的重要因素之一。以下是一些常见的网站速度优化技巧:
1. 压缩图片
图片是网站中常见的资源,但过多的图片会导致页面加载缓慢。通过压缩图片,可以减小文件大小,提高加载速度。
// 使用Pillow库压缩图片
from PIL import Image
import os
def compress_image(image_path, output_path, quality=85):
with Image.open(image_path) as img:
img.save(output_path, 'JPEG', quality=quality)
# 示例:压缩图片
compress_image('original.jpg', 'compressed.jpg')
2. 使用CDN
CDN(内容分发网络)可以将网站资源分发到全球各地的服务器,用户访问时从最近的服务器获取资源,从而提高加载速度。
<!-- 在HTML中添加CDN链接 -->
<link rel="stylesheet" href="https://cdn.example.com/css/style.css">
3. 减少HTTP请求
减少页面中的HTTP请求可以加快页面加载速度。以下是一些减少HTTP请求的方法:
- 合并CSS和JavaScript文件
- 使用精灵图
- 使用字体图标
二、网站响应式设计
随着移动设备的普及,响应式设计已成为网站优化的重要方向。以下是一些响应式设计技巧:
1. 使用媒体查询
媒体查询可以针对不同屏幕尺寸的设备应用不同的样式。
/* 媒体查询示例 */
@media (max-width: 768px) {
.container {
width: 100%;
}
}
2. 使用Flexbox或Grid布局
Flexbox和Grid布局可以方便地实现响应式布局。
/* Flexbox布局示例 */
.container {
display: flex;
justify-content: space-between;
}
三、网站内容优化
网站内容是吸引用户的关键。以下是一些网站内容优化技巧:
1. 优化标题和描述
标题和描述是搜索引擎优化的关键因素,优化它们可以提高网站在搜索引擎中的排名。
<!-- 优化标题和描述 -->
<title>网站标题</title>
<meta name="description" content="网站描述">
2. 优化图片和视频
图片和视频是网站内容的重要组成部分,优化它们可以提高用户体验。
<!-- 优化图片 -->
<img src="image.jpg" alt="图片描述">
<!-- 优化视频 -->
<video controls>
<source src="video.mp4" type="video/mp4">
您的浏览器不支持视频标签。
</video>
四、总结
量推前端优化是提升网站用户体验的关键。通过优化网站速度、响应式设计和内容,我们可以打造一个高效、美观、易用的网站。希望本文能帮助您轻松掌握网站优化技巧,提升用户体验。
